Kia Soul EV vs. Nissan LEAF
In comparing the Kia Soul EV to the Nissan LEAF, The Nissan LEAF has the advantage in the areas of interior volume and base engine power. Based on this comparison of the Kia Soul EV versus the Nissan LEAF, the Nissan LEAF is a better car than the Kia Soul EV.
Engine Power and Fuel Efficiency Comparison
For engine performance, the Kia Soul EV’s base engine makes 109 horsepower, and the Nissan LEAF base engine makes 147 horsepower. Both the Soul EV and the LEAF are rated to deliver an average of 124 miles per gallon of gasoline-equivalent (MPGe), with highway ranges of 111 and 150 miles respectively. Both models use electricity. The charge time for the Soul EV is 33 hours (120V), while the charge time for the LEAF is 8 hours (240V).
Passenger Space Comparison
The Nissan LEAF, a electric compact car, has the advantage of offering more interior volume, reflected in more front head room, front leg room, and cargo space. The Kia Soul EV, a electric subcompact car, has the advantage in the areas of front shoulder room, rear head room, rear shoulder room and rear leg room.
Safety Ratings Comparison
The Nissan LEAF has an average safety rating of 5 out of 5 Stars based on NHTSA's crash test ratings.

The Kia Soul EV is a five-door hatchback/crossover that brings a green drivetrain to one of Kia’s most popular small vehicles. If you like the Soul but want a green powertrain and don’t mind a much lower range, you’ll love the Soul EV.
Summary Review
Nissan’s four-door hatchback Leaf was the original battery-electric vehicle of the modern age. This ground-breaking EV has topped sales charts globally for affordable EVs for years. The Leaf offers many shoppers an attractive package that's hard to ignore.
